#e06d34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e06d34 is composed of 87.8% red, 42.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 19.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 54.1%. #e06d34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da68 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e06d34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e06d34 has RGB values of R:224, G:109,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.77,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14708020.

Shades and Tints of #e06d34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df4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e06d34
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8885 is the less saturated color, while #fb6419 is the most saturated one.
